AI Contract Overview
The contract requires the packaging, labeling, and palletization of bolt shipments in strict compliance with MIL-STD-129 and RP001 palletization standards for deliveries to DLA depots. All work must adhere to U.S. military specifications for traceability, labeling accuracy, and secure handling to ensure seamless integration into defense logistics systems. The place of performance is designated as Hill AFB with a zip code of 84056-5734, and the work falls under NAICS code 493190, indicating specialized warehousing and storage services tied to military supply chains. This is a total small business set-aside under SBA guidelines, meaning only small businesses certified by the Small Business Administration are eligible to bid. The solicitation was posted on July 26, 2026, with a response deadline of August 3, 2026, and it is classified as a subcontract opportunity linked to the Department of Defense’s Aviation Supply Chain division. Interested parties must respond via the DIBBS platform using the provided RFQ link to be considered for award.
